Foreign affairs minister says Australian government ‘deeply concerned’ about reports Sean Turnell has been detained in Myanmar
The Australian government has called in Myanmar’s ambassador after Sean Turnell, an Australian economic adviser to Aung San Suu Kyi, was detained after a military coup.
Turnell, who is also an economics professor at Macquarie University in Sydney, told Reuters he was being detained, but has been uncontactable since Saturday.
